Transaction e86e7e3427e72f9a12828521b16f4d969cec84b6cacd4aa5868ae96db1f127f3

2 Input
2 Outputs
  • e86e7e3427e72f9a12828521b16f4d969cec84b6cacd4aa5868ae96db1f127f3:0
  • value  505770
    address  133bpzmmzYhHS4BMvb4GbdLQ1VNUM8VPAE
  • e86e7e3427e72f9a12828521b16f4d969cec84b6cacd4aa5868ae96db1f127f3:1
  • value  1567407
    address  34oG133SkpLXfGnqwN3fRmUvtaCrwQLMKW